Saurang is a Rural village located in Puncha, Purulia, West-bengal.

The total population of Saurang is 1,501.

Saurang village comprises 274 households.

The literacy rate in Saurang is 69.5%. Among the literate population of 860, there are 525 literate males and 335 literate females.

In Saurang, there are 765 males and 736 females, with a sex ratio of 962 females per 1000 males.

There are 263 children (17.5% of population), comprising 146 boys and 117 girls.

The total number of workers in Saurang is 882, with 313 main workers and 569 marginal workers.

In Saurang, there are 108 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(57 males, 51 females) and 347 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(177 males, 170 females).

Saurang is located in West-bengal state, Purulia district, and falls under Puncha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 331134 and LGD code is 331134.
